Log House Staining in Longmont, CO
Log house staining services involve applying protective and decorative finishes to the exterior surfaces of wooden log homes. This process helps enhance the natural beauty of the logs while providing a barrier against weather elements such as moisture, UV rays, and temperature changes. Projects typically include staining entire log exteriors, touch-up work on specific sections, or refreshing existing finishes to maintain the home’s appearance and structural integrity over time.
Homeowners interested in log house staining usually want to understand the types of stains available, the benefits of regular maintenance, and how the process can protect their investment. It’s important to consider the condition of the logs beforehand, including any signs of damage or deterioration, and to select a stain that suits the local climate and the desired aesthetic. Proper preparation and application are essential for achieving a durable finish that preserves the log home’s beauty for years to come.

Log House Staining Questions
What types of log house staining services are available? Services include protective staining, color enhancement, and restoration to maintain the appearance and durability of log homes.
How often should a log house be stained? Typically, staining is recommended every 3 to 5 years to preserve the wood and prevent damage.
What should property owners consider before staining a log house? It's important to assess the current condition of the wood and choose a stain that suits the property's style and climate.
Can staining improve the appearance of an aged or weathered log house? Yes, staining can refresh the look and help protect the wood from further weathering and damage.
